Our premium PP Fire Retardant Sheet is an advanced thermoplastic engineering solution designed to overcome the inherent flammability of standard polypropylene. By integrating specialized flame-retardant masterbatches and high-performance carriers, we have developed a material that meets the rigorous UL94 safety standards, effectively eliminating fire hazards in critical industrial environments.

Engineered for versatility and durability, these sheets are produced through a precise high-temperature solution and coagulation process. This ensures a homogenous structure that combines superior fire resistance with the classic strengths of PP, including exceptional chemical stability, low toxicity, and high impact strength, making it an ideal choice for safety-critical infrastructure.

Q: What is the difference between V0 and V2 grades of PP fire retardant sheets?

V0 is the highest flame retardancy level where burning stops within 10 seconds and no flaming drips occur. V2 allows for flaming drips but still requires the fire to extinguish within a specified time.

Q: Can PP fire retardant sheets be welded?

Yes, our sheets maintain excellent welding and processing properties, allowing them to be fabricated into complex shapes using standard PP welding techniques.
